> > Hi!  I was trying to use pydev (1.4.6.2788 ) with eclipse 3.4.1 and
> > imported:
> > http://code.google.com/p/jythonconsole/
> > I found that if I run the project as a jython run, it runs well.
> However,
> > if I try to debug it, the console terminates without ever displaying a
> > frame.  Any suggestions?
>
> Hi William,
>
> I've taken a look at it and it seems that's a jython bug when running with:
>
> -Dpython.security.respectJavaAccessibility=false
>
> The debugger needs that flag to gather the info on the java stuff
> (even when not running in debug mode with that flag it'll have the
> behavior you described).
>
> Now, if you change in console.py (in the main function)
> frame.visible = True
>
> to
>
> frame.setVisible(True)
>
> at least it'll appear (and not finish the debug session), but it still
> won't behave properly (there are probably other related things to
> that).
>
> As a side note, for some reason it seems that jython is not calling
> the tracing function correctly in the console (it could be that the
> console or one of its dependencies is using the tracing facilities and
> removing the debugger).
